How much do forecasting research scientist j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for forecasting research scientist in the United States is $130,117.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$107,500.00 and $173,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

Meta runs one of the largest server fleets on earth, and every product bet (AI training, ranking, inference, storage) turns into a demand for compute that we must forecast, shape, and match to a physical supply of servers, racks, power, and data center space. As the senior technical owner of Server Demand Planning, you own the demand side of that equation and close the loop with supply: you forecast long- and near-term server capacity demand by rack/hardware type and region, and you build the operations-research models that match that demand to supply so we land the right servers, in the right place, at the right time. You set the modeling approach for the function, decide when to ship a production-grade optimization system versus a fast lightweight model to unblock a decision, and act as the connective tissue between product/service capacity owners, capacity engineering, supply chain, data center planning, and finance.
Research Scientist, Server Demand Responsibilities:
  • Own the multi-horizon server/MW demand forecast long range (2-5+ years), by resource type and DC supply requirements.
  • Aggregate and normalize demand signals from short term demand and product groups, into a single trusted statistical long term demand plan.
  • Formulate and solve the demand-supply matching problem using operations-research models that reconcile forecasted demand with hardware roadmaps, cooling, lead times, and power constraints to inform the Plan of Record.
  • Build across the full modeling spectrum: production-grade optimization and forecasting systems and prototype models and heuristics that answer a leadership question or unblock a decision.
  • Set functional standards: define the operating model, bridge short- and long-term forecasts, track accuracy and supply-matching metrics, and bridge forecast-to-actual gaps.
  • Partner with IDC engineering, site selection, and hardware strategy teams to align next-generation data center designs, rack sizing, and hardware roadmaps with demand, eliminating stranded power, cooling, and space capacity.
